The chance of earthquake damage in Hamilton County is about the same as New York average and is lower than the national average. The risk of tornado damage in Hamilton County is lower than New York average and is much lower than the national average.

Other Weather Extremes Events

A total of 8,684 other weather extremes events within 50 miles of Hamilton County were recorded from 1950 to 2010. The following is a break down of these events:

TypeCountTypeCountTypeCountTypeCountTypeCount
Avalanche:0Blizzard:5Cold:118Dense Fog:1Drought:23
Dust Storm:0Flood:1,064Hail:1,516Heat:43Heavy Snow:362
High Surf:4Hurricane:0Ice Storm:21Landslide:1Strong Wind:189
Thunderstorm Winds:4,397Tropical Storm:2Wildfire:3Winter Storm:239Winter Weather:134
Other:562

Historical Earthquake Events

A total of 6 historical earthquake events that had recorded magnitudes of 3.5 or above found in or near Hamilton County.

Distance (miles)DateMagnitudeDepth (km)LatitudeLongitude
22.91983-10-075.31343.94-74.26
23.51983-10-074.1843.95-74.26
16.71971-05-233.9343.9-74.5
37.01980-06-063.8143.56-75.23
16.71971-07-103.7143.9-74.5
16.71971-06-213.6143.9-74.5
